What is part time drafting?

Part time drafting involves creating technical drawings or plans, usually for architecture, engineering, or manufacturing projects, on a part-time basis. Drafters use computer-aided design (CAD) software to convert ideas and specifications into precise diagrams. Part-time positions are ideal for students, those seeking work-life balance, or individuals supplementing other jobs. The role may include updating existing drawings, collaborating with engineers or architects, and ensuring compliance with industry stand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time drafting professional?

To thrive as a Part Time Drafting professional, you need proficiency in technical drawing, attention to detail, and a background in drafting or a related field, often supported by a relevant certification or coursework. Familiarity with CAD software such as AutoCAD, Revit, or SolidWorks is typically required for creating and modifying technical plans. Strong organizational skills, effective communication, and the ability to collaborate with engineers and architects help set you apart. These skills are essential for producing accurate, high-quality drawings that support project success and efficient teamwork.

What are some common challenges faced by part time drafting professionals, and how can they be managed?

Part-time drafting professionals often face challenges such as adapting to varying project timelines, staying updated with changing software, and integrating effectively with full-time team members despite working fewer hours. To manage these, clear communication with supervisors about availability and deadlines is crucial, as is maintaining proficiency in drafting tools like AutoCAD. Proactively seeking updates on project changes and participating in team meetings, even remotely, can help ensure smooth collaboration and timely delivery of work.

What is the difference between Part Time Drafting vs Part Time CAD Technician?

AspectPart Time DraftingPart Time CAD Technician
CredentialsDrafting certifications, technical school diplomaCAD software proficiency, technical diploma or certification
Work EnvironmentArchitectural, engineering, or construction firmsDesign firms, engineering companies, manufacturing
Industry UsageCommonly used in architecture and engineeringUsed across various design and engineering fields
Job FocusCreating technical drawings and plansDeveloping detailed CAD models and drawings

Part Time Drafting involves creating technical drawings manually or with basic CAD tools, focusing on drafting plans. Part Time CAD Technicians typically work with advanced CAD software to develop detailed models. While both roles require technical skills and industry knowledge, CAD Technicians often have more specialized software training, making their work more detailed and precise.
